Skip to content

Commit f371fc4

Browse files
bench: refactor to use string interpolation
PR-URL: stdlib-js#9763 Ref: stdlib-js#8647 Reviewed-by: Athan Reines <kgryte@gmail.com>
1 parent 7f68fc4 commit f371fc4

File tree

3 files changed

+13
-10
lines changed

3 files changed

+13
-10
lines changed

docs/migration-guides/mathjs/benchmark/benchmark.abs.array.float64.js

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-30,6 +30,7 @@ var strided = require( '@stdlib/math/strided/special/abs' );
3030
var dabs = require( '@stdlib/math/strided/special/dabs' );
3131
var abs = require( '@stdlib/math/special/abs' );
3232
var tryRequire = require( '@stdlib/utils/try-require' );
33+
var format = require( '@stdlib/string/format' );
3334
var pkg = require( './../package.json' ).name;
3435

3536

@@ -43,7 +44,7 @@ var opts = {
4344

4445
// MAIN //
4546

46-
bench( pkg+'::stdlib:math/strided/special/abs:value=array,dtype=float64,len=100', opts, function benchmark( b ) {
47+
bench( format( '%s::stdlib:math/strided/special/abs:value=array,dtype=float64,len=100', pkg ), opts, function benchmark( b ) {
4748
var x;
4849
var y;
4950
var i;
@@ -66,7 +67,7 @@ bench( pkg+'::stdlib:math/strided/special/abs:value=array,dtype=float64,len=100'
6667
b.end();
6768
});
6869

69-
bench( pkg+'::stdlib:math/strided/special/dabs:value=array,dtype=float64,len=100', opts, function benchmark( b ) {
70+
bench( format( '%s::stdlib:math/strided/special/dabs:value=array,dtype=float64,len=100', pkg ), opts, function benchmark( b ) {
7071
var x;
7172
var y;
7273
var i;
@@ -89,7 +90,7 @@ bench( pkg+'::stdlib:math/strided/special/dabs:value=array,dtype=float64,len=100
8990
b.end();
9091
});
9192

92-
bench( pkg+'::stdlib:math/special/abs:value=array,dtype=float64,len=100', opts, function benchmark( b ) {
93+
bench( format( '%s::stdlib:math/special/abs:value=array,dtype=float64,len=100', pkg ), opts, function benchmark( b ) {
9394
var x;
9495
var y;
9596
var i;
@@ -115,7 +116,7 @@ bench( pkg+'::stdlib:math/special/abs:value=array,dtype=float64,len=100', opts,
115116
opts = {
116117
'skip': true
117118
};
118-
bench( pkg+'::mathjs:abs:value=array,dtype=float64,len=100', opts, function benchmark( b ) {
119+
bench( format( '%s::mathjs:abs:value=array,dtype=float64,len=100', pkg ), opts, function benchmark( b ) {
119120
var x;
120121
var y;
121122
var i;

docs/migration-guides/mathjs/benchmark/benchmark.abs.array.generic.js

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-29,6 +29,7 @@ var uniform = require( '@stdlib/random/base/uniform' ).factory;
2929
var strided = require( '@stdlib/math/strided/special/abs' );
3030
var abs = require( '@stdlib/math/special/abs' );
3131
var tryRequire = require( '@stdlib/utils/try-require' );
32+
var format = require( '@stdlib/string/format' );
3233
var pkg = require( './../package.json' ).name;
3334

3435

@@ -42,7 +43,7 @@ var opts = {
4243

4344
// MAIN //
4445

45-
bench( pkg+'::stdlib:math/strided/special/abs:value=array,dtype=generic,len=100', opts, function benchmark( b ) {
46+
bench( format( '%s::stdlib:math/strided/special/abs:value=array,dtype=generic,len=100', pkg ), opts, function benchmark( b ) {
4647
var x;
4748
var y;
4849
var i;
@@ -65,7 +66,7 @@ bench( pkg+'::stdlib:math/strided/special/abs:value=array,dtype=generic,len=100'
6566
b.end();
6667
});
6768

68-
bench( pkg+'::stdlib:math/special/abs:value=array,dtype=generic,len=100', opts, function benchmark( b ) {
69+
bench( format( '%s::stdlib:math/special/abs:value=array,dtype=generic,len=100', pkg ), opts, function benchmark( b ) {
6970
var x;
7071
var y;
7172
var i;
@@ -87,7 +88,7 @@ bench( pkg+'::stdlib:math/special/abs:value=array,dtype=generic,len=100', opts,
8788
b.end();
8889
});
8990

90-
bench( pkg+'::mathjs:abs:value=array,dtype=generic,len=100', opts, function benchmark( b ) {
91+
bench( format( '%s::mathjs:abs:value=array,dtype=generic,len=100', pkg ), opts, function benchmark( b ) {
9192
var x;
9293
var y;
9394
var i;

docs/migration-guides/mathjs/benchmark/benchmark.abs.complex_number.js

Lines changed: 4 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,7 @@ var Complex128 = require( '@stdlib/complex/float64/ctor' );
2727
var base = require( '@stdlib/math/base/special/cabs' );
2828
var abs = require( '@stdlib/math/special/abs' );
2929
var tryRequire = require( '@stdlib/utils/try-require' );
30+
var format = require( '@stdlib/string/format' );
3031
var pkg = require( './../package.json' ).name;
3132

3233

@@ -40,7 +41,7 @@ var opts = {
4041

4142
// MAIN //
4243

43-
bench( pkg+'::stdlib:math/base/special/cabs:value=complex_number', opts, function benchmark( b ) {
44+
bench( format( '%s::stdlib:math/base/special/cabs:value=complex_number', pkg ), opts, function benchmark( b ) {
4445
var x;
4546
var y;
4647
var i;
@@ -68,7 +69,7 @@ bench( pkg+'::stdlib:math/base/special/cabs:value=complex_number', opts, functio
6869
b.end();
6970
});
7071

71-
bench( pkg+'::stdlib:math/special/abs:value=complex_number', {
72+
bench( format( '%s::stdlib:math/special/abs:value=complex_number', pkg ), {
7273
'skip': true
7374
}, function benchmark( b ) { // FIXME: update once complex supported in top-level abs
7475
var x;
@@ -98,7 +99,7 @@ bench( pkg+'::stdlib:math/special/abs:value=complex_number', {
9899
b.end();
99100
});
100101

101-
bench( pkg+'::mathjs:abs:value=complex_number', opts, function benchmark( b ) {
102+
bench( format( '%s::mathjs:abs:value=complex_number', pkg ), opts, function benchmark( b ) {
102103
var x;
103104
var y;
104105
var i;

0 commit comments

Comments
 (0)